The assumption that the moon had an internal magnetic field produced in
the same way as the geomagnetic field requires that the moon rotated
faster than the angular velocity at which it would break up. This
suggests that a lunar dynamo is not a tenable explanation for the
magnetic remanence observed on the moon.
